Nitrile(NBR) Rubber

Nitrile(NBR) Rubber

With Excellent resistance to oils, solvents and fuels. Resistant to a broader range of aromatic hydrocarbons than neoprene. Nitrile may be blended with SBR rubber to achieve an economically priced sheet or moderately oil resistant applications. Temperature range: -30°C to +120°C, with the possibility of reaching -40°C.

Neoprene (CR) Rubber

Neoprene (CR) Rubber

  1. Excellent mechanical and abrasion properties even without reinforcing fillers.
  2. Good resistance to heat, ozone and weathering.
  3. Resistance to chemicals; resistant to inorganic chemical products , except oxidising acids and halogens. 
  4. Moderate resistance to aliphatic hydrocarbons.

Silicon Rubber

Silicon Rubber

  1. Silicone rubber is physiologically inert, thus making it the preferred choice of the medical, pharmaceutical and food processing industries.
  2. Silicones have comparatively low mechanical properties, tensile strength, elongation and tear strength, however they keep constant even at high temperatures but should not be used with high pressure steam.
  3. Resistance to chemicals; its resistance to oils and hydrocarbon products is fairly limited and similar to that of Chloroprene rubbers.
  4. Reasonable resistance to a whole range of general chemical products, but acids, alkalis, esters and ketone should be avoided
